The Nrf5340 Datasheet is far more than just a collection of technical specifications; it's a detailed blueprint that empowers developers to design, build, and optimize their wireless products. It meticulously outlines the Nrf5340's dual-core architecture, its extensive peripheral set, and its advanced power management features. Understanding this document is crucial for anyone looking to leverage the Nrf5340's capabilities for applications ranging from smart home devices and industrial sensors to wearable technology and advanced medical equipment. The document provides everything from electrical characteristics and timing diagrams to pin assignments and register descriptions, ensuring that every aspect of the SoC's operation can be understood and controlled.
These datasheets serve as the definitive source of truth for hardware designers, firmware developers, and system integrators. They enable the precise selection of components, the accurate design of printed circuit boards (PCBs), and the efficient development of robust software. Consider the key aspects covered within the Nrf5340 Datasheet
- Core architecture details
- Radio and connectivity specifications (Bluetooth Low Energy, Thread, etc.)
- Memory organization and access
- Peripherals and their functionalities
- Power consumption profiles and optimization techniques

Here's a simplified breakdown of what you'll find:
| Section | Content Focus |
|---|---|
| Electrical Characteristics | Voltage, current, and temperature specifications. |
| Pin Descriptions | Functionality of each pin on the chip. |
| Peripheral Registers | Control and status registers for various peripherals. |
| Radio Performance | Transmitter and receiver capabilities. |
